The Property

Set just moments from the sands of Langland Bay and the charm of Mumbles Village, 14 Langland Road is an elegant Victorian semi-detached villa of considerable presence, now offered in its entirety as a substantial private home.

Extending to over 3,500 sq ft, the property is arranged across four storeys, combining graceful period architecture with outstanding proportions, a sense of light and volume, and the rare luxury of gardens giving direct access to Underhill Park plus off-street parking.

The interiors are flooded with natural light via a series of tall sash windows and bay frontages, many of which frame views across Underhill Park or towards Swansea Bay. The layout allows for versatility across multiple living zones, currently configured as two independent apartments—each with its own entrance, kitchen, bathrooms, reception rooms and generous bedrooms—but easily reimagined as a single, cohesive family home.

Highlights include:

An impressive double reception room with bay window and fireplace

A superb open-plan kitchen/living/dining space with access to a West-facing sun deck

Eight bedrooms, including a spacious principal suite with walk-in wardrobe and en-suite

Three additional bathrooms

Private gardens to front and rear, the rear enjoying direct access into Underhill Park

Ample off-street parking.

The house was refurbished in parts in 2021, and while much of the accommodation is in excellent condition, there remains scope for cosmetic updating—an opportunity to create a landmark coastal home of scale and distinction.

Whether you reconfigure the layout into one grand family home or retain a self-contained annexe or multi-generational arrangement, 14 Langland Road offers a unique blend of history, elegance, lifestyle, and potential in one of South Wales' most desirable settings.

The property is share of freehold
The property is connected to all mains services and the central heating is fired by gas.
The Council tax is Band E (£2,619p.a.) (Each apartment currently).
The EPC rating is D
